About Our Client
We are seeking an experienced Plant Manager for an international automotive manufacturing company. The role carries full responsibility for the operational, financial, and organizational performance of the production plant. This is a senior leadership position with direct influence on plant strategy, operational excellence, and long-term sustainability.
Key Responsibilities
  • Full responsibility for plant operations, including production, logistics, maintenance, quality, and HSE.
  • Achievement of production, quality, cost, and delivery targets.
  • Leadership, development, and performance management of the plant management team.
  • Implementation and continuous improvement of Lean Manufacturing and operational excellence standards.
  • Budget ownership, cost control, and capital investment management (CAPEX).
  • Ensuring compliance with customer requirements, quality standards (e.g. IATF 16949), and legal regulations.
  • Risk management, workplace safety, and environmental compliance.
  • Regular reporting of KPIs and plant performance to senior management.
  • Collaboration with customers and suppliers on strategic initiatives and escalations.
Candidate Profile
  • University degree (preferred in engineering or manufacturing).
  • Minimum 7–10 years of experience in manufacturing management, preferably in the automotive industry.
  • Proven experience in leading a production plant or a major manufacturing unit.
  • Strong knowledge of Lean, Continuous Improvement, KPI-driven management, and process optimization.
  • Demonstrated leadership skills with experience managing large teams.
  • Excellent communication and decision-making abilities.
  • Fluent English is required; additional languages are an advantage.
  • Strategic mindset with a strong focus on results and continuous improvement.
